PSV Eindhoven vs Utrecht prediction time comes with a bit of spring drama attached. Mark your calendars for 2026-04-04 at 15:30 GMT, when PSV welcome Utrecht to the Philips Stadion. PSV are still the standard-setters in the Eredivisie, sitting top with a huge cushion, and they are even flirting with the “earliest title” conversation. But the mood has shifted slightly after two surprise slips: a 3-2 defeat to NEC Nijmegen and an even more eye-catching 3-1 loss to Telstar.
Those dropped points mean PSV can’t officially pop the champagne on April 4. Still, the script is simple: do their job against Utrecht, then keep one eye on Feyenoord the next day versus Volendam. Utrecht, for their part, arrive in a healthy 7th place and with a calm confidence after a 2-0 win over Go Ahead Eagles—exactly the kind of result that keeps a top-half season feeling purposeful.
Peter Bosz’s PSV usually play the game in the opponent’s half: fast circulation, lots of runners, and a steady stream of shots. Even after those recent stumbles, the identity is clear—PSV want to turn matches into long waves of pressure, with the full-backs high and the front line constantly rotating to create space for a final pass or a cutback.
Utrecht under Ron Jans have been one of the league’s better “problem-solvers.” They can sit compact, break with purpose, and make set pieces count. Jans also added a bit of theatre this week: with his retirement expected at season’s end, he joked about enjoying being the party pooper—before stressing Utrecht’s motivation is simply to compete, not to play villain.
